Murfreesboro Woman Busted on Shoplifting Charges With Close To $3,000 in Stolen Merchandise Recovered

Dec 20, 2012 at 02:03 pm by bryan


A Murfreesboro woman was one of about 60-arrested at the CoolSprings Galleria in Franklin for shoplifting. Franklin Police say they have recovered upwards of $20,000 in merchandise shoplifted from the CoolSprings Galleria since Black Friday.

Police in Franklin report the operation dubbed “Not in Our Mall,” remains in full force.

Officers arrested 31-year-old Lacey Locke of Murfreesboro and recovered nearly $3,000 in stolen merchandise from her car. Undercover officers recognized Locke as the same woman who got away with more than $700 in stolen perfume and designer handbags this past Saturday. She is also wanted by Sumner County authorities on unrelated charges. Locke is due in Williamson County Court 01/03/2013 at 2:00 pm. 

Officers also arrested Rodney Hutson, who was with her at the time of the theft. Hutson was wanted by Metro Police on unrelated charges.
